Mark William Goldsworthy, 69, of Roscoe, IL, passed away in his home on Saturday, September 17, 2022. Mark was born on June 24, 1953 to William and Dora (Pardi) Goldsworthy in Beloit, WI. Mark graduated from Beloit Catholic High School in 1971. He was employed at Taylor Company in Rockton, IL for 42 years and retired in 2019. While at Taylor Company, he made a lot of great friends in his travels and enjoyed being of assistance to them all over the world. In his early years he enjoyed working on race cars and later, riding his motorcycles with his friends and cruising in his collector Mercedes convertible. He lived his life to the fullest.
Mark will be missed by brother, Richard (Kathy) Goldsworthy; sister, Janice Goldsworthy; son, Matt (Kellie) Whitledge; daughter, Lisa (Bill) Hanke; grandchildren, Ryan Whitledge, Blayse Whitledge, Cole Hanke, and Lucas Hanke; nephews, Brad (Melisa) Goldsworthy, Andy (Courtney) Goldsworthy, DJ (Alisha) Goldsworthy; and niece, Sarah (Tim) Hahn; 10 great nieces and nephews; and good friend, Stephanie King. Mark was predeceased by his father and mother.
